| 0:00.0 | This is Max Locato. My friend Jerry has taught me the value of gratitude. |
| 0:06.0 | His dear wife Ginger battles Parkinson's disease. |
| 0:10.0 | And what should have been a wonderful season of retirement has been marred by multiple hospital stays, medication, and struggles. |
| 0:19.0 | Yet Jerry never complains. |
| 0:21.0 | I asked Jerry his secret. He said, every morning Ginger and I sit together and sing a hymn. |
| 0:27.9 | I ask her what she wants to sing and she always says, count your many blessings. |
| 0:34.1 | So we sing it. |
| 0:35.4 | Look at your blessings. |
| 0:36.9 | Do you see any? |
| 0:37.9 | Do you see any friends, family, grace from God, |
| 0:40.6 | the love of God, any abilities or talents, as you look at your blessings, take note of what |
| 0:45.8 | happens. |
| 0:46.8 | Anxiety grabs his bags and slips out the door. |
| 0:50.8 | Worry refuses to share the heart with gratitude. |
| 0:53.0 | Focus more on what you have and less on what you don't. |
